What is Saffron?

Saffron is a spice derived from the Crocus sativus flower, also known as the saffron crocus. The stigma and styles of this flower are dried and used to create saffron threads, which are then used as a seasoning, dye, or perfume.

- Advertisement -

Saffron has been used in traditional medicine for centuries and is thought to be beneficial for a variety of health conditions. Today, saffron is being studied for its potential role in treating several health conditions, including Alzheimer’s disease, cancer, and depression.

Alzheimer’s disease

Some studies suggest that saffron may help improve cognitive function in people with Alzheimer’s disease. In a small study of 20 people with Alzheimer’s disease, those who took 30 milligrams (mg) of saffron twice daily for 16 weeks showed improvements in their ability to perform daily activities and had less anxiety and depression than those who did not take saffron.

The History of Saffron

Saffron is a spice that has been used for centuries in many different cultures. It is derived from the crocus flower and has a long history of being used as a dye, medicine, and flavorings.

The first recorded use of saffron was in ancient Mesopotamia where it was used as a perfume or incense. In ancient Egypt, it was used to embalm mummies and as a cosmetic. In ancient Greece and Rome, saffron was used as a medication for various ailments such as colds, fevers, and digestive problems. It was also used to flavor food and beverages.

During the Middle Ages, saffron was used as a dye for clothing and other fabrics. It was also used in religious ceremonies and as an ingredient in medicinal potions. In the Renaissance, saffron was once again popular for its medicinal properties. It was also used to flavor food and drinks.

Saffron fell out of favor during the Industrial Revolution when other synthetic dyes and flavors became available. How to Use Saffron

When it comes to saffron, a little goes a long way. This intensely flavorful and aromatic spice is derived from the stigmas of Crocus sativus flowers, and just a few threads are enough to impart flavor and color to dishes. Saffron is used in both sweet and savory recipes, from rice dishes and desserts to soups and stews.

To use saffron, first steep the threads in warm water for about 10 minutes to release their flavor. Then add the saffron-infused water (along with the threads) to your dish at the appropriate stage of cooking. Depending on the recipe, you may also need to grind or crush the threads before adding them to the dish.

When stored properly in an airtight container away from light, saffron will stay fresh for up to 2 years.
